    fall·back
    [ˈfôlˌbak]
    noun
    fallback (noun) · fallbacks (plural noun) · fall-back (noun) · fall-backs (plural noun)
    1. an alternative plan that may be used in an emergency:
      "teaching was a last resort, a fallback"
    2. a reduction or retreat:
      "the offering will hit the market after a fallback from record highs"
